The angle, in degrees, at which to search for non-zero pixels.
maxDistance
Integer
The maximum distance, in pixels, over which to search.
labelBand
String, default: null
If provided, multi-band inputs are permitted and only this band is used for searching. All other bands are returned and populated with the per-band values found at the searched non-zero pixels in the label band.
